Transaction 29f5f053bd6608561e6c253e33e38903c28bdee96f1c60bbbaf0f2db4e307ee8
1 Input
1 Output
-
29f5f053bd6608561e6c253e33e38903c28bdee96f1c60bbbaf0f2db4e307ee8:0
- value
- 2946873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ef76eb8763a954ed8359103286f5122bce4c23b OP_EQUAL
- address
- 3EixHhHJay251DW92B6TFPugCTCgXpHTWN